Trait Approach
A theory of leadership that suggests certain inherent personality traits and characteristics are conducive to effective leadership.
Skills Approach
A perspective on leadership that emphasizes the importance of developing specific, learnable abilities and competencies for effective leadership.
Style Approach
A leadership paradigm that emphasizes the significance of a leader's manner of interaction with followers, focusing on task-oriented and relationship-oriented behaviors.
Great Person Approach
A theory suggesting that leadership is inherent in certain individuals who possess unique traits making them naturally suited to lead.
